Transaction 3b8169730feb6acc6d44233be144df5e628b39462fd04ae6a43a37328af927eb
1 Input
1 Output
-
3b8169730feb6acc6d44233be144df5e628b39462fd04ae6a43a37328af927eb:0
- value
- 301267546
- script pubkey
- OP_0 OP_PUSHBYTES_32 1d4fb1cb41baf1ebd8f1a7847387d1c45fa6121b8299ff0dcdabf396c410e86f
- address
- bc1qr48mrj6phtc7hk8357z88p73c306vysms2vl7rwd40eed3qsaphsw2g4n7